Where else but at Pebble Beach can you be driving down the road behind 15 Ferrari' and get stopped by 3 Italian designers from The Giugiaro Design Firm because you are driving a Subaru and are the only car that has the right size lug wrench to fit the wheel spacers on their Mustang concept car?

We loaned them the lug wrench and threw stick to our buddy the border collie while they changed tires. To support the car they used a stack of amazing design folios that were to be given away at the concourse. I know they are amazing because Goffredo gave Kelly one as a thank you.

He also gave her his card and I was like "Hey!" but then he invited us to Visit the studios in Torino next time we are in Italy.

He doesn't know it, but i'm going to show up next summer on his door step. (IMG:style_emoticons/default/smilie_pokal.gif)
